Hethersett planning approval rate
Hethersett ward in Broadland has a 95.5% approval rate based on 111 planning decisions. Broadland overall: 93.2%.

Hethersett sits slightly above the Broadland average, with a 2.3 point advantage. Planning outcomes here are generally favourable.
